Austin Pets Alive! Opens New Thrift Store in Pflugerville to Benefit Animal Welfare Programs
In the heart of Pflugerville, Texas, a new establishment is mingling commerce with animal care as Austin Pets Alive! unveils its latest thrift store. This site at 15803 Windermere Dr. is the fifth of its kind in Central Texas, with its grand opening event having kicked off this past Saturday. The nonprofit organization, known for its efforts in animal welfare, promises that all net proceeds generated by the thrift store will circle back to directly support its life-saving programs and the numerous animals fostered within its care.
Brushy Creek State Recreation Area to Undergo $2M Campground Upgrades
Brushy Creek State Recreation Area, a key destination for outdoor enthusiasts in Iowa, is set for extensive upgrades totaling more than $2 million. These enhancements aim to modernize the facilities to better serve the current demands of campers and visitors. The announcement was made at a recent public open house hosted by the Department of Natural Resources (DNR) at the park’s Prairie Resource Center.

This week in Texas music history: Dolores Fariss is born
On April 18, 1912, country bandleader Dolores Fariss was born in Hutto, Texas. She spent most of her life in the Govalle area of Austin graduated from Austin High. Her musical career began as a piano player in her father’s polka band, and it was in that role that she met her future husband and bandmate Lee in 1930. The two married the following year in San Marcos, and in the early 1940s Dolores organized the country band Dolores and the Bluebonnet Boys with Lee on drums.
